    Preparation and Application of Siloxane Modified Polyimide Coating for Solid Phase Microextraction

    • Siloxane modified polyimide was synthesized from 3,3′,4,4′-benzophenonetetracarboxylic dianhydride, 4,4′-diaminodiphenylether and 1,3-bis(-3-aminopropyl)-tetramethyldisiloxane, using N,N-dimethylformamide as solvent, and used as coating material for quartz fibre in SPME. Molecular structure, thermostability and surface morphology of the siloxane modified polyimide was studied by IRS, TG and SEM. It was shown that by introduction of siloxane chain segments into molecular structure of polyimide, the flexibility is raised, the polar action between the molecular chains is decreased and the adsorptivity is improved, and that by dehydration at high temperature, the coating material is bonded with the quartz fibre on its surface, making the coating to adhere more firmly and to behave a more stable character. SPME with quartz fibre coated with the siloxane modified polymide was applied to GC-determination of 7 benzene homologues in water samples. Good efficiency of separation was obtained, and in the GC analysis for the 7 benzene homologues, values of RSD′s (n=6) found were in the range of 4.1%-6.0%, detection limits (3S/N) found were in the range of 0.02-0.11 mg·L-1, and values of recovery found by standard addition method were in the range of 98.0%-117%.
